		<description>We&#039;re doing some amount of measuring.  Specifically, we&#039;re measuring how many hours we spent programming each week, how many stories we under- and over-estimated, how many stories we expected to finish but didn&#039;t.  So we probably could establish an average underestimate percentage based on that.

I&#039;d rather leave that as a bit of a last resort: for one thing, I think we have more of an estimation problem on long stories than on small stories, which suggests to me that we have to be better about splitting stories.  But if we don&#039;t get some traction on our estimates soon, I think that applying a blanket percentage makes sense.</description>
